Central Africa
Where the first explorers set out to discover and map the great unknown continent. Unrivalled game-viewing and wide open wilderness are the trademarks of Zambia, from tracking the magnificent wildlife in the South & North Luangwa National Parks, to bird-watching in the Kafue & Lochinvar National Parks. The mighty Zambezi river provides a wonderful contrast, whilst the Victoria Falls are an experience in themselves.

Malawi, the ‘warm heart of Africa’, is sculptured by the Great Rift Valley, and boasts safari opportunities in the Liwonde & Nyika National Parks. However, it is the Lake Malawi which is nearly 600kms long and which offers an unusual beach stay, for which this land-locked paradise is most famous.
